IN NO EVENT SHALL THE COPYRIGHT 20// OWNER OR CONTRIBUTORS BE LIABLE FOR ANY DIRECT, INDIRECT, INCIDENTAL, 21// SPECIAL, EXEMPLARY, OR CONSEQUENTIAL DAMAGES (INCLUDING, BUT NOT 22// LIMITED TO, PROCUREMENT OF SUBSTITUTE GOODS OR SERVICES; LOSS OF USE, 23// DATA, OR PROFITS; OR BUSINESS INTERRUPTION) HOWEVER CAUSED AND ON ANY 24// THEORY OF LIABILITY, WHETHER IN CONTRACT, STRICT LIABILITY, OR TORT 25// (INCLUDING NEGLIGENCE OR OTHERWISE) ARISING IN ANY WAY OUT OF THE USE 26// OF THIS SOFTWARE, EVEN IF ADVISED OF THE POSSIBILITY OF SUCH DAMAGE. 27 28#include "hydrogen-redundant-phi.h" 29 30namespace v8 { 31namespace internal { 32 33void HRedundantPhiEliminationPhase::Run() { 34 // We do a simple fixed point iteration without any work list, because 35 // machine-generated JavaScript can lead to a very dense Hydrogen graph with 36 // an enormous work list and will consequently result in OOM. Experiments 37 // showed that this simple algorithm is good enough, and even e.g. tracking 38 // the set or range of blocks to consider is not a real improvement. 39 bool need_another_iteration; 40 const ZoneList<HBasicBlock*>* blocks(graph()->blocks()); 41 ZoneList<HPhi*> redundant_phis(blocks->length(), zone()); 42 do { 43 need_another_iteration = false; 44 for (int i = 0; i < blocks->length(); ++i) { 45 HBasicBlock* block = blocks->at(i); 46 for (int j = 0; j < block->phis()->length(); j++) { 47 HPhi* phi = block->phis()->at(j); 48 HValue* replacement = phi->GetRedundantReplacement(); 49 if (replacement != NULL) { 50 // Remember phi to avoid concurrent modification of the block's phis. 51 redundant_phis.Add(phi, zone()); 52 for (HUseIterator it(phi->uses()); !it.Done(); it.Advance()) { 53 HValue* value = it.value(); 54 value->SetOperandAt(it.index(), replacement); 55 need_another_iteration |= value->IsPhi(); 56 } 57 } 58 } 59 for (int i = 0; i < redundant_phis.length(); i++) { 60 block->RemovePhi(redundant_phis[i]); 61 } 62 redundant_phis.Clear(); 63 } 64 } while (need_another_iteration); 65 66#if DEBUG 67 // Make sure that we *really* removed all redundant phis. 68 for (int i = 0; i < blocks->length(); ++i) { 69 for (int j = 0; j < blocks->at(i)->phis()->length(); j++) { 70 ASSERT(blocks->at(i)->phis()->at(j)->GetRedundantReplacement() == NULL); 71 } 72 } 73#endif 74} 75 76} } // namespace v8::internal 77
